WebOct 22, 2009 · Darlin' Nelly Gray (Song with guitar, banjo and mountain dulcimer) gadaya 1.68K subscribers 19K views 13 years ago "Darling Nelly Gray" is a 19th c. popular song composed by … WebThe song was written and composed by Benjamin Hanby, and published by Oliver Ditson and Company of New York in 1856. The plain cream white cover features black title text in a floral patterned frame. The song tells the story of a runaway slave pining for his love, Nelly Gray, still in slavery in Georgia.
